What Causes This Problem

  • Heavy rains often cause sewage backups into residential properties.
  • Malfunctioning septic systems leak black water into basements.
  • Storm flooding introduces contaminated water from nearby canals.
  • Pipe ruptures release hazardous water into living spaces.
  • Overflow of municipal sewage lines contaminates private properties.

Weston’s subtropical climate, with frequent heavy rainfall near the Everglades Parkway, increases risks of water contamination. Homeowners must remain vigilant about water intrusion risks. Service Cost In Weston, FL

Typical black water cleanup costs in Weston vary based on contamination extent but generally range from $1,500 to $5,000 including disposal and sanitization services.

How Long Does Black Water Cleanup Usually Take?

The timeframe depends on contamination extent but typically ranges from one to three days, including removal, sanitation, and drying.

Can I Stay In My Home During The Cleanup?

Depending on contamination levels, it may be unsafe to remain onsite, but we assess and advise you for your safety.

Is Black Water Cleanup Covered By Insurance?

Many insurance policies cover black water damage if it results from covered events; we help document for your claim.

How Do You Prevent Mold After Black Water Cleanup?

We use specialized drying and antimicrobial treatments to prevent mold growth following black water extraction.
